Which expression is correct for the work done in adiabatic reversible expansion of an ideal gas
Options
(a) W = nRT ln V₂ / V₁
(b) Cv ( T₂ – T₁)
(c) W = PΔV
(d) W = -²∫₁ PdV
Correct Answer:
Cv ( T₂ – T₁)
Explanation:
work done in adiabatic reversible expansion of an ideal gas = Cv (T₂ – T₁).
